The doctor's comment


A joint meeting of specialists (Deputy Director of Center for Pediatric Hematology, Oncology, and Immunology A.A. Maschan, Head of the Department of Clinical Immunology I.V. Kondratenko, Head of the Department of Marrow Transplantation E.V. Skorobogatova) has analyzed the medical record of Sergei Safiullin, born June 3, 2008. Diagnosis: X-linked severe combined immunodeficiency, confirmed by molecular genetic examination. There is evidence for familial history of severe combined immunodeficiency, laboratory evidence for the same disorder, and characteristic infectious complications. For all these reasons, the patient should receive allogeneic transplantation of hematopoietic stem cells from a haploidentical donor. In view of the danger of severe infectious complications, the conditioning should be started as soon as possible.

Graft processing for haploidentical transplantation of hematopoietic stem cells requires purchase of a set for T-cell depletion (CD3, CD19 depletion on a Clinimacs apparatus). The approximate cost of this set is 350,000 roubles ($10,000-$11,000, depending on the rouble/dollar exchange rate).

10.04.2009 We are completing the fundraising for the benefit of Sergei Safiullin. The kid is presently at the Department of Marrow Transplantation, recovering after his BMT. The transplantation was to be performed without delay, and therefore the system for graft purification was purchased on credit.
